Nope. You're taking two different pain relievers in the Motrin and the DayQuil and two different allergy medicines in Zyrtec and DayQuil. If you have a cold, take DayQuil by itself. If you have Allergies and pain, take Zyrtec and Motrin.
No, you do not take two versions of the same medicine together. Both Zyrtec-D and Dayquil have an antihistamine/decongestant combination. Doubling up on decongestants will make your heart race and could make you feel anxious and jittery. Choose one or the other, but not both together.

Together? That is a Big NO! No. Benadryl and hydroxyzine are both antihistamines. Hydroxyzine is prescribed by your doctor only ; it has a more potent effect that increase the chances of drowsiness. You can take one or the other -not both- when symptoms are present.
